Punktgruppen
Punktgruppen, or point groups, are mathematical groups formed by the symmetry operations that leave at least one point fixed in three-dimensional space. They describe the rotational and reflectional symmetries of finite objects such as molecules and nanoparticles, as well as the non-translational symmetry of crystals when translations are disregarded. The symmetry operations include the identity, proper rotations about axes, mirror reflections in planes, inversion through a center, and improper rotations (a rotation followed by reflection).
